Output 3a9f062f451c976028a4e252568134b1d470a707f91d475116b059e0ca1b3f93:1

value
702692168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9debdafabb56e5b776477afb41ecd3f6eb3a297a OP_EQUAL
address
3G62ZBSV2CgVLsRyGaqvo5J7DXmH7551nA
transaction
3a9f062f451c976028a4e252568134b1d470a707f91d475116b059e0ca1b3f93
spent
true